a. Arrange the following microorganisms according to size and predation from largest to smallest: bacteria, virus, protozoa, crustaceans. (4 marks) b. Explain the process of nitrification with the help of equations. What types of bacteria are involved in the process? Name them. (6 marks) c. What are the common sources of wastewater? List them and provide the main objectives of wastewater treatment. (5 marks) d. In a conventional wastewater treatment plant, three stages are prominent. Describe each stage in detail, the objective of the stage (what does the stage remove) and differences (advantages /disadvantages) of each stage. (15 marks) e. Differentiate between suspended growth and attached growth wastewater treatment processes. Give an example in each case. (4 marks) f. Three different methods can be used to measure the organic content of wastewater. Define them. (6 marks) g. What are the main objectives of treatment of sludge?

Answers

Largest to smallest: Crustaceans, Protozoa, Bacteria, and Viruses. The nitrification process can be understood as the biological oxidation process of ammonia to nitrate.

This process occurs in two stages. During the first stage, ammonia is converted into nitrite by Nitrosomonas bacteria. In the second stage, nitrite is oxidized to nitrate by Nitrobacter bacteria.The two-step process of nitrification can be shown by the following chemical reactions:
NH₃ + O₂ → NO₂ + H₂O
NO₂ + ½O₂ → NO₃
The Nitrosomonas bacteria and Nitrobacter bacteria are involved in the process of nitrification. c. The common sources of wastewater are domestic wastewater, industrial wastewater, and agricultural wastewater. The main objectives of wastewater treatment are:to remove harmful pollutants from wastewater to protect the environment, andto recover and recycle the valuable resources present in wastewater.
d. In a conventional wastewater treatment plant, there are three stages, which are primary treatment, secondary treatment, and tertiary treatment. The objectives of each stage are as follows:
1. Primary treatment: This stage removes large, heavy solids and floating debris from the wastewater. The objective of this stage is to reduce the amount of organic matter and suspended solids in the wastewater.
2. Secondary treatment: This stage removes dissolved and suspended organic matter from the wastewater using biological processes. The objective of this stage is to reduce the amount of organic matter, nitrogen, and phosphorus in the wastewater.
3. Tertiary treatment: This stage removes remaining suspended solids, dissolved solids, and nutrients from the wastewater. The objective of this stage is to produce effluent that can be safely discharged into the environment.
The differences (advantages/disadvantages) of each stage are as follows:
1. Primary treatment: Advantages - simple and low cost; Disadvantages - does not remove all the organic matter and nutrients.
2. Secondary treatment: Advantages - more effective than primary treatment; Disadvantages - requires more space and energy than primary treatment.
3. Tertiary treatment: Advantages - produces high-quality effluent; Disadvantages - requires advanced treatment technologies and higher cost.
e. Suspended growth wastewater treatment process refers to the use of microorganisms suspended in the wastewater to treat it. The microorganisms convert organic matter into biomass and other compounds. An example of this process is the activated sludge process.The attached growth wastewater treatment process refers to the use of microorganisms attached to a surface to treat the wastewater. The microorganisms form a biofilm on the surface, which helps in the treatment process. An example of this process is the trickling filter process.
f. The three different methods used to measure the organic content of wastewater are:
1. Chemical Oxygen Demand (COD) - It measures the amount of oxygen required to oxidize organic matter in wastewater.
2. Biological Oxygen Demand (BOD) - It measures the amount of oxygen consumed by microorganisms in the process of decomposing organic matter in wastewater.
3. Total Organic Carbon (TOC) - It measures the amount of carbon present in the organic matter in wastewater.
g. The main objectives of sludge treatment are:
to reduce the volume of sludge, andto stabilize the sludge by reducing the pathogens, organic matter, and odors present in the sludge.

Arisia puts $500.00 into a savings account with an annual simple interest rate of 4.5%
If the interest rate stayed the same, how much interest would Arisia’s account earn after 15 years?

Answers

Answer:

Simple interest is calculated by multiplying the principal amount (the initial deposit) by the interest rate and the number of years.

The formula for simple interest is:

I = P * r * t

Where:

I = Interest

P = Principal (initial deposit)

r = Interest rate (expressed as a decimal)

t = Time (in years)

In this case, the principal amount is $500.00, the interest rate is 4.5% (converted to 0.045), and the time is 15 years.

We can plug in the values into the formula:

I = $500.00 * 0.045 * 15 = $337.50

So, after 15 years with the same interest rate, Arisia’s account would earn $337.50 in interest.

A telephone number has the form NXX-ABC-XXXX. Today N is 2-9, and X is 0-9. However, there are exceptions as 37X and 96X are reserved for future use. Additionally N9X is reserved for expanding the total numbers at a later date. Finally, N11 is reserved for service numbers. How many total area codes are currently available given this information?

Answers

Answer:

The total area codes that are currently available is 692.

Step-by-step explanation:

The area code is of the form: NXX.

The variable N can take values,

N = {2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8 and 9}

The variable X can take values,

X = {0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8 and 9}

Considering that repetitions are allowed.

The total possible number of area codes is:

T = 8 × 10 × 10 = 800

So, there are 800 possible area codes.

The exception codes are:

{37X, 96X, N9X and N11}

There are 10 possible combinations for 37X.There are 10 possible combinations for 96X.There are 80 possible combinations for N9X.There are 8 possible combinations for N11.

So, the number of reserved area codes is, 10 + 10 + 80 + 8 = 108.

Then the area codes that are currently available is, 800 - 108 = 692

Thus, the total area codes that are currently available is 692.

What is the minimum hot-holding temperature for fried shrimp? a. 105 ° F41 ° C b. 115 ° F46 ° C c. 125 ° F52 ° C d. 135 ° F 57 ° C

Answers

The minimum hot-holding temperature for fried shrimp is d. 135 ° F 57 ° C. It is important to maintain this temperature to ensure that the food remains safe for consumption and to prevent the growth of harmful bacteria.

The minimum hot-holding temperature for fried shrimp is 135 °F (57 °C). When food is hot-held, it means it is kept at a specific temperature after cooking to maintain its quality and safety until it is served or consumed. This temperature is important because it helps prevent the growth of harmful bacteria, such as Salmonella and E. coli, that can cause food borne illnesses.

At a hot-holding temperature of 135 °F (57 °C) or higher, the heat inhibits the growth of bacteria, ensuring that the fried shrimp remains safe for consumption. This temperature range is considered a critical control point in food safety practices.

It's worth noting that the temperature of 135 °F (57 °C) is the minimum requirement for hot-holding fried shrimp. However, in practice, it's generally recommended to hold the shrimp at a slightly higher temperature to account for any temperature loss that may occur over time.

Some food establishments may set their hot-holding equipment to maintain a temperature of 140 °F (60 °C) or higher to ensure the safety and quality of the food.

By adhering to proper temperature control guidelines, including maintaining the minimum hot-holding temperature of 135 °F (57 °C), you can help prevent the risk of food borne illnesses and ensure that the fried shrimp remains safe and enjoyable to consume.
